P. M. Narendra is a scholar working on Aerospace Engineering, Electrical and Electronic Engineering and Computer Vision and Pattern Recognition. According to data from OpenAlex, P. M. Narendra has authored 15 papers receiving a total of 889 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Aerospace Engineering, 7 papers in Electrical and Electronic Engineering and 3 papers in Computer Vision and Pattern Recognition. Recurrent topics in P. M. Narendra’s work include Infrared Target Detection Methodologies (7 papers), CCD and CMOS Imaging Sensors (4 papers) and Calibration and Measurement Techniques (3 papers). P. M. Narendra is often cited by papers focused on Infrared Target Detection Methodologies (7 papers), CCD and CMOS Imaging Sensors (4 papers) and Calibration and Measurement Techniques (3 papers). P. M. Narendra collaborates with scholars based in United States, Canada and India. P. M. Narendra's co-authors include Keinosuke Fukunaga, M. Goldberg, Warren Koontz, Robert Fitch, Thomas S. Huang and Ipseeta Menon and has published in prestigious journals such as IEEE Transactions on Pattern Analysis and Machine Intelligence, Pattern Recognition and IEEE Transactions on Computers.
